Market Size and Overview
The Global Surgical Robots Market size is estimated to be valued at USD 9,447.5 million in 2026 and is expected to reach USD 23,785.7 million by 2033, exhibiting a compound annual growth rate (CAGR) of 14% from 2026 to 2033.
This robust expansion accounts for increasing adoption in minimally invasive procedures and evolving regulatory landscapes favoring technological integration. The Surgical Robots Market Forecast also reflects escalating demand from oncology, orthopedics, and urology segments, underpinning extensive market opportunities and driving market revenue globally.

Impact of Geopolitical Situation on Supply Chain
A landmark case in 2024 involved supply chain disruptions caused by escalating U.S.–China trade tensions impacting semiconductor availability critical for surgical robots. The resulting delays in key component shipments caused temporary setbacks in production lines for major market players, affecting market revenue projections across North America and Asia-Pacific. This geopolitical friction emphasized the need for diversified supplier sourcing and localized manufacturing strategies, shaping surgical robots market growth strategies to hedge against similar risks and ensuring continuity in the global hospital supply chains.
